Progress Software neemt functionaliteit van de in Nederland ontwikkelde Base Development Kit (BDK) op in de volgende versies van de 4GL-ontwikkeltool. Dit zei topman en oprichter Joe Alsop op de gebruikersconferentie van zijn bedrijf in Boston.
"Het is nog te vroeg om te speculeren welke onderdelen we overnemen, maar we zijn zeker geïnteresseerd."
Het BDK-initiatief is afkomstig uit Nederland, waar zes Progress-gebruikers samen met de lokale afdeling van het softwarebedrijf hebben gezocht naar een uitbreiding van de Progress-omgeving. Het probleem was volgens de gebruikers dat er een conceptuele kloof gaapt tussen de 4GL-tool, waarvan de eerste versie in 1981 is ontwikkeld, en nieuwere ontwikkelingen, zoals Enterprise Java Beans. Het initiatief heeft ertoe geleid dat Progress in ieder geval in versie 9.2 van de software, waarvan de uitgave-datum nog niet vaststaat, delen van BDK zal opnemen. Ook versie 9.1, die dit jaar uitkomt, bevat waarschijnlijk BDK-functionaliteit.
Volgens Edwin Lijnzaad, technisch directeur van de Nederlandse partner Vitalogic, bereidt BDK de 4GL-ontwikkeltool voor op component gebaseerde ontwikkeling (component based development). Verder tracht het BDK-consortium de onderhoudsproblemen van applicaties aan te pakken. BDK voegt daarvoor aan de Smart Object-technologie van Progress toepassingen toe die het onderhoud moeten verbeteren.
Het consortium onderhandelt nog met Progress over welke functionaliteit wordt overgenomen. De initiatiefgroep ziet BDK als een uitbreiding van de Application Development Method (ADM), één van de hulpmiddelen die deel uitmaken van Progress. Of Progress deze lijn volgt, is nog niet zeker.
Progress kondigde tijdens de conferentie de volgende generatie aan van zijn Java-ontwikkelomgeving Apptivity. De nieuwe applicatieserver krijgt de codenaam Vader. Deze versie combineert volgens Alsop alle functionaliteit die bedrijven nodig hebben voor hun onderlinge (business-to-business) handel via Internet. Vader integreert EJB’s, XML (eXtensible Markup Language) en Java Messaging Service. Met dit platform kunnen bedrijven toepassingen bouwen waardoor bijvoorbeeld wederverkopers automatisch via Internet producten kopen als hun toeleverancier de prijs hiervan verlaagt.